Transaction 0514816f1604701d69efc505c23d88aad3f6b7847b410a232aff3a60c3badf2b

block
eafe77022203eff30d35a361825c8a907fc21a1f402d19cbb543cbbea4ceab0e

2 Inputs

2 Outputs